Joining the Troop
If you are interested in coming to a troop meeting - we meet Tuesday evenings from 7:00 until 8:30 at Gary United Methodist Church in downtown Wheaton, IL. Eagle Scout project creates accessible planters
Scouts from Troop 35 built several wheelchair accessible planters at the Sensory Garden Playground in the Danada South area of the DuPage Forest Preserve. They worked with the Wheaton Park District, built the planters from the ground up and filled … Continue reading
